AssetMark Inc's Q4 2015 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2015, AssetMark Inc held 1,585 positions worth $5.4B, up 13% from $4.79B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 26% of the portfolio.

AssetMark Inc deployed $533M of net new capital in Q4 2015, opening 679 new positions and adding to 664 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was iShares Global Consumer Discretionary ETF: 1,343,842 shares worth $120M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 1.7% of assets, up from 1.3% a quarter earlier, followed by Real Estate and Technology.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was iShares 1-3 Year Treasury Bond ETF, an estimated $84.5M trimmed.
